Jai un compte GoDaddy avec un domaine et un hébergement, et je vois que je peux transférer les sous-domaines dans https://dcc.godaddy.com/ ou rediriger les sous-domaines dans Hébergement-> Paramètres -> « Redirections dURL ».

Quelle est la différence entre la redirection ou le transfert dun sous-domaine?

Réponse

Pour GoDaddy, forwarding redirige chaque URL dun domaine vers un autre domaine à laide de redirections 301. Il sagit dun service gratuit (ou du moins inclus sans frais supplémentaires avec enregistrement de domaine).

Avec le transfert, voici quelques exemples de ce qui se passe:

  • http://example.com/ 301 redirige vers http://myrealdomain.tld/
  • http://example.com/page.html 301 redirige vers http://myrealdomain.tld/page.html
  • http://example.com/directory/ 301 redirige vers http://myrealdomain.tld/directory/

Godaddy propose Redirection dURL dans le cadre de lhébergement (un service payant). Vous avez beaucoup plus de contrôle sur les redirections avec lhébergement. Voici leur documentation sur la redirection via lhébergement . Vous pouvez:

  • Contrôler le type de redirection (301 vs 302)
  • Rediriger lensemble du domaine comme le transfert
  • Rediriger juste un chemin spécifique sur le domaine
  • À laide de Linux cPanel, redirigez un chemin générique

Commentaires

  • Transfert est exactement ce que je veux faire et cela fonctionne pour http://example.com/ à http://myrealdomain.tld/ , mais les chemins relatifs sont ne fonctionne pas … cela prend un certain temps pour entrer en vigueur.
  • @JoeFletch Cela ne prend généralement pas longtemps pour entrer en vigueur. Assurez-vous que vous utilisez le type de transfert approprié. Seules les redirections 301 et 302 sans masquage conservent le chemin.
  • Oui! Il a fallu quelques heures pour entrer en vigueur! Merci pour votre réponse!

Réponse

Transfert et lURL équivaut à Rediriger une URL. Est le même concept. Vous pouvez utiliser les mots de manière interchangeable.

Cependant, bien que redirection se réfère normalement à la pratique consistant à envoyer un code détat HTTP 30x (généralement 301 pour les redirections permanentes et 302 pour les redirections temporaires) le mot transfert prend un sens plus large. En fait, plusieurs entreprises ( y compris GoDaddy ) proposent différents types de transfert:

  • forward (redirection)
  • transférer avec masquage

Transférer une URL en utilisant la technique de masquage signifie quau lieu de rediriger vers la cible de manière transparente, lURL cible est ouverte dans un cadre afin que le visiteur puisse toujours voir lURL source dans la barre dadresse.

Réponse

Un transfert est effectué côté serveur et une redirection est effectuée côté client.

Lorsque vous transférez quelque chose, le serveur transmet la demande à un autre serveur / page et leur permet de gérer la demande. Cela peut être totalement transparent pour le client et même masquer lURL. Si vous transférez example.com vers example.net, lutilisateur final verra toujours example.com dans la barre dadresse tout en naviguant réellement sur example.net

Lorsque vous redirigez, vous envoyez une réponse au client indiquant d’aller ailleurs. Si lutilisateur accède à example.com et que vous le redirigez vers example.net, vous envoyez généralement une réponse 30x avec ladresse à laquelle vous souhaitez quil aille. Le navigateur de lutilisateur fait alors une deuxième requête à example.net et y navigue manuellement.

Commentaires

  • Bien que votre réponse soit correcte dans certains contextes , ce nest pas ainsi que GoDaddy utilise la terminologie. Ce serait la différence correcte entre le transfert et la redirection dans le contexte du framework Java Servlet.

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*